The Poarch Band of Creek Indians will install the
InvoTech UHF-RFID Uniform Management System at the Wind Creek Montgomery Hotel & Casino which is scheduled to open in December 2015.
InvoTech’s Uniform System communicates with a White Conveyors U-Pick-It uniform delivery system that ensures the correct garments reach each team member quickly to save time and reduce uniform handling expenses.

“Wind Creek Hospitality installed InvoTech’s UHF-RFID Uniform Management System at its Wind Creek Wetumpka Hotel & Casino in 2013. The system proved to be a good fit for our operation,” said Rick Shuford, human resources director for Wind Creek Hospitality’s northern Alabama properties. “We selected InvoTech to be in all our properties because it reduces labor and loss expenses by automating our entire uniform management process from dirty garment drop off to clean uniform pick-up. InvoTech works perfectly with our White Conveyors uniform delivery system.”
The InvoTech UHF-RFID Uniform System will track and provide automated reports on uniforms for approximately 700 team members. Wind Creek Hospitality properties use a White Conveyors U-Pick-It System that automatically delivers the correct clean uniform items to staff. InvoTech communicates with the delivery system to simplify and automate each property’s operation by tracking when staff members retrieve their uniform with their employee ID card. The efficient process means the casinos’ uniform accounting is accurate without the added expense of manual processes and recordkeeping.
“Wind Creek Hospitality recognized that having the same efficient uniform system and processes at each of its properties makes it easy for team members to move between locations without additional training,” said Oswald Lares, director of sales and marketing for InvoTech Systems. “Property team members each have a RFID employee ID card that InvoTech’s system reads to track uniform delivery, laundry processes, and the number of cleaning cycles so managers can accurately budget for replacement costs.”
